
This story gets a little crazy. In a bid to get a one-way ticket to either jail or the Institute of Mental Health (IMH), a severely mentally ill man told the police that he wanted to join the Islamic State and bomb Singapore.
37-year-old Lee Soo Liang — who has a history of depression, schizophrenia and bipolar disorder — made the hollow threat in the hopes that he would be reunited with his mother and former girlfriend, both current residents at IMH.
